Add network specific BSSID black and white lists

This change adds the configuration options "bssid_whitelist" and
"bssid_blacklist" used to limit the AP selection of a network to a
specified (finite) set or discard certain APs.

This can be useful for environments where multiple networks operate
using the same SSID and roaming between those is not desired. It is also
useful to ignore a faulty or otherwise unwanted AP.

In many applications it is useful not just to enumerate a group of well
known access points, but to use a address/mask notation to match an
entire set of addresses (ca:ff:ee:00:00:00/ff:ff:ff:00:00:00).

This change expands the data structures used by MAC lists to include a
mask indicating the significant (non-masked) portions of an address and
extends the list parser to recognize mask suffixes.

+# Example configuration blacklisting two APs - these will be ignored
+# for this network.
+network={
+	ssid="example"
+	psk="very secret passphrase"
+	bssid_blacklist=02:11:22:33:44:55 02:22:aa:44:55:66
+}
+
+# Example configuration limiting AP selection to a specific set of APs;
+# any other AP not matching the masked address will be ignored.
+network={
+	ssid="example"
+	psk="very secret passphrase"
+	bssid_whitelist=02:55:ae:bc:00:00/ff:ff:ff:ff:00:00 00:00:77:66:55:44/00:00:ff:ff:ff:ff
+}
